Is A Prominent Stomach Bubble Present In Fetus A Cause For Concern?

Question: I've just had my 20 week Anomaly scan and been advised my baby has a prominent stomach bubble,What does this mean?I had an ultrasound at 16 weeks and everything was fine!

Prominent stomach bubble is present in fetus with duodenal atresia or intestinal atresia.
It poses a risk of Downs syndrome in the baby.
What is the AFI (amniotic fluid index) mentioned in the scan?
Is there any other anomaly mentioned.
